    Support Services Analyst

    MAIN FUNCTIONS 

    • Performs a variety of professional, technical and analytical duties in the operation of enterprise, client/server and desktop computer systems and networks.
    • Analyzes, detects, identifies and corrects technical problems and deficiencies.
    • Configures and installs computer hardware and software.
    • Manages inventory control of IT equipment and supplies.
    • Upgrades hardware and software components.
    • Maintains IT hardware asset and software tracking.
    • Monitors and collects data on system performance. Position will receive direction and support.
    • This position level would typically include junior Technical Analyst performing mostly basic tasks.

    Job Requirement

    • Extensive working knowledge of PCs, network hardware, operating systems, software and network communication protocols.
    • Excellent communication and customer service skills.

    Cost / Schedule / Controls Engineer / Specialist III

    Description

    • Perform or coordinate effort for cost estimate preparation, estimating oversight and quality assurance reviews for Company operated and Other Builder Operator estimates for all Gate and Funding milestones.
    • Prepare Check Estimates and Schedules to compare with Operated by Others (OBO) Operator-prepared submittals.
    • Participate in estimate / Schedule assessments (verification of project cost & schedule bases).
    • Participate in Estimating Group process efficiency tools and quality assurance review process improvements.
    • Responsible for maintaining change control, cost reports, etc.
    • Work with project estimator, planner and scheduler and Client’s accounting staff
    • Coordinate and assemble the monthly progress reports
    • Work closely with client’s project manager and team leads for regulated and non-regulated accounting reporting requirements

    Job Requirement

    •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ering within discipline or equivalent professional experience
    • Previous experience in a closely related position
    • Skills to negotiate and broker successful solutions between Internal Coordination parties above
    • Advanced level proficiency in Cost Estimating, Project Planning and Project Controls
    • Strong Influencing, consulting, mentoring, analytical, and computing skills
    • Adaptability to changing priorities
    • Strong interpersonal and communication skills
    • Ability to organize, plan, control, coordinate, and effectively manage cross-functional activities

    SSHE Technician II

    Description

    • Work with company and contractor’s site management and Safety, Security, Health, and Environment (SSHE) organizations to implement the project and site safety programs and advice on best practice.
    • Provide support in one or more safety, security, health, or environmental subject areas to a particular site or functional group within an affiliate.
    • Supports data entry, management, and reporting skills while interacting with the field/operations organization and SSHE Advisors.
    • Cover some but not all of the responsibilities listed below.
    • Typical Position titles may include: EHS (Environmental, Health and Safety) Specialist, EHS Technician, Offshore Installation (OI) Technician, Emissions Technician, Safety Technician, etc.
    • Preparation of monthly Safety Stewardship, Progress and Executive Reports by acquiring and analyzing data, preparing trend analysis, and generating supporting graphs, tables, and statistics.
    • Point of contact for incident management program
    • Responsible for maintaining and analyzing data contained in the Project's Safety Database.
    • Identifying, proposing, and implementing new safety initiatives / awareness programs, i.e. management presentations, poster programs
    • Identify trends in safety data and recommend initiatives

    Job Requirement

    • Experience in Construction Safety-related positions (previous experience within the group preferred)
    • High School Graduate
    • Post-Secondary Diploma in Safety Technology
    • Health, Safety and Security experience
    • Ability to multitask
    • Effective team player skills
    • Local and international travel may be required
    • Strong computer skills in the following programs are essential attributes for this role: MS Excel, MS PowerPoint, MS Word
    • Experienced in Fire Fighting
